Transaction 514082b95ade20dc0665e7a54537b8f7f4badc2e82ddc9dedab59d359e977151
1 Input
1 Output
-
514082b95ade20dc0665e7a54537b8f7f4badc2e82ddc9dedab59d359e977151:0
- value
- 88499450
- script pubkey
- OP_0 OP_PUSHBYTES_20 e70b0dcbc97b248a4352d66e387650f56a1f51d7
- address
- ltc1quu9smj7f0vjg5s6j6ehrsajs744p75whqt6jvp